The rondomedia Marketing & Vertriebs GmbH is a German publisher of computer games . The company is mainly active in the lower or middle price segment.

history

Rondomedia was founded in April 1998 by André Franzmann, who is still the majority shareholder of the company today. Franzmann managed the company until January 2014, when his long-time managing director Kristina Klooss took over sole responsibility. The majority of the rondomedia group also include the publisher astragon Software GmbH and New Planet Distributions GmbH. At the end of July 2015, the rondomedia group was restructured, with the name of the subsidiary astragon being chosen as the future name of the group of companies. Rondomedia became astragon Sales & Services GmbH. This company mainly coordinates the retail activities of the group of companies. Astragon Software GmbH became astragon Entertainment GmbH as part of the restructuring. This is where the development and publishing activities of the astragon group have been bundled. A new company logo and a new CI, which will be presented to a wide audience for the first time at Gamescom 2015, round off the restructuring.

The original corporate goal was to establish itself with casual games and secondary marketing in the mid-price segment of the German games market. In 1998 the company entered into a partnership with the US publisher eGames (including eGames Mahjongg Master ), for which rondomedia took over the publication on the German market. The cooperation was extended in 2003, by then rondomedia had distributed around one million titles from eGames, around a third of which fell on the various versions of Mahjongg Master . Further collaborations were concluded with Atari , Ubisoft , THQ , Square Enix , Daedalic and other publishing partners, for whose games rondomedia in Germany mostly took on the marketing in the budget area ( best-of series). rondomedia also created a casual series called Play & Smile , Astragon also marketed the Bigfish Games series.

From 2008 the company benefited from the increasing success of simulations such as astragon's farming simulator and construction simulator . According to the company, a new target group - mainly men, 35 years and older - could be reached with the titles, which the leading game manufacturers did not serve. These would be addressed by the leisurely gameplay, the technical simulation, the low hardware requirements and the low price. In the trade press, however, the games hardly received any approval, as they could not compete with large-scale productions either in terms of production value or the design of the game principle. As of 2010, it was a question of comparatively inexpensive productions with sales figures of usually 50,000 up to a peak of around 250,000 copies before the start of secondary marketing. As of 2012, the company began to cut back on the secondary marketing and distribution of licensed titles in order to concentrate more on the international marketing of its own titles, especially in the simulation area. Today rondomedia is mainly active as a publisher in the areas of simulation and casual games for the Windows, Mac, iOS and Android platforms. rondomedia markets the products via traditional retailers, but also worldwide via online distribution. The company has also been operating the online portal simuwelt.de since April 2012 . The website is a sales, entertainment and news platform for fans of simulation games. In July 2015, the uniform name change to the astragon group took place.

Change of name

On July 23, 2015, the former rondomedia Marketing & Vertriebs GmbH was renamed astragon Sales & Services GmbH. The former astragon Software GmbH has been called astragon Entertainment GmbH since then. The background to this is the decision of the two former publishers rondomedia and astragon to operate as the astragon group from now on and thus achieve a uniform market presence. With a common logo and the common name astragon, the focus is on the market strength in the field of technical and everyday simulations, for which the former astragon Software GmbH was already known. While astragon Sales & Services will concentrate on distribution in the Germany - Austria - Switzerland region in the future, all games will be published by the publisher astragon Entertainment. Astragon Entertainment GmbH will also be responsible for the international marketing of the games and brands.
